coming from a car audio install background, I have always customized the stereo systems in my vehicles, though as i get older i find that i want to mess with them less and less. my 2008 ram had the factory infinity system that I completely removed and replaced with a nice aftermarket alpine/infinity system, my parents had a 2012 with the factory alpine system and I was really unimpressed with how it sounded as well. I just got my 2020 with the HK system and I have to say I am really impressed with the sound quality for a factory installed system. The subwoofer hits nicely and the speakers sound great for my preference. I will say there are tons a factors that play in to how a stereo sounds in a vehicle, #1 being your personal preference. I have a mega cab which im sure sounds very different than a CC. The source will also have a huge impact. am/fm is pretty much always terrible, Bluetooth can be better but there are a lot of settings in your phone/app that can effect the sound quality, for example my phone has an EQ for audio playback that includes bluetooth output. The app I use to stream also has EQ settings that can be adjusted.

Satellite radio sounds terrible due to bandwidth issues. They compress the hell out of the music before transmitting the broadcast. Bluetooth is okay, but not capable of transferring music at even CD level quality, so the best option is to use a CD (pre 2020 truck IIRC) or whatever digital player you like (thumb drive, apple product, etc...) directly connected to the USB port.

As far as the system itself, my HK system was okay, but nothing great. The ANC kills the low end response from the factory subwoofer, and the factory speakers are cheaply built coaxials with built in passive crossovers in the dash and headliner and separate midbass (6x9)/tweeter components in the door.
